Makro da Tablo Ekleme

Katılım
29 Aralık 2008
Mesajlar
21
Excel Vers. ve Dili
2007
İyi akşamlar.

Full test şablon isimli içerisinde tablo bulunan excell dosyam var, 1 tane de sürekli ismi değişen excell dosyam var. Kişisel makro kaydettim.

Sürekli ismi değişen excell dosyamda kişisel makroyu çalıştırıp , full test şablon excellinden tablo/veri aldırmaya çalışıyorum. Ancak her defasında dosya ismi farklı olacağı için 2. seferde makro çalışmıyor. Yardımcı olabilir misiniz?

Kalın ile işaretlediğim yere ne yazmam gerekmektedir?

iyi çalışmalar.
saygılarımla.



Sub Sablon()
'
' Klavye Kısayolu: Ctrl+Shift+Z
'
With Selection
.HorizontalAlignment = xlGeneral
.VerticalAlignment = xlTop
.WrapText = True
.Orientation = 0
.AddIndent = False
.IndentLevel = 0
.ShrinkToFit = False
.ReadingOrder = xlContext
.MergeCells = True
End With
Selection.UnMerge
Rows("15:15").Select
Selection.Insert Shift:=xlDown, CopyOrigin:=xlFormatFromLeftOrAbove
Range("A15").Select
Windows("FULL TEST ŞABLON.xls").Activate
Range("A2:F7").Select
Selection.Copy
Windows("sonuclar.xls").Activate
ActiveSheet.Paste
Range("A1:E3").Select
End Sub
 
Son düzenleme:

ÖmerBey

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2012
Mesajlar
4,324
Excel Vers. ve Dili
2007 Türkçe
Merhaba,
Kodlarınızın başına Set w1 = ThisWorkbook satırını ilave ediniz. Daha sonra da koyu renkle işaretlediğiniz yeri w1.Activate koduyla değiştirip deneyiniz.
 
Katılım
29 Aralık 2008
Mesajlar
21
Excel Vers. ve Dili
2007
Merhaba,
Kodlarınızın başına Set w1 = ThisWorkbook satırını ilave ediniz. Daha sonra da koyu renkle işaretlediğiniz yeri w1.Activate koduyla değiştirip deneyiniz.
dediğiniz gibi değiştirdim. Ancak kopyala yaptıktan sonra mevcut excele geri dönüp yapıştırma yapmadı. hata da vermedi.

Makro, personal makrolar içerisinde kısayol tuşu kullanıyorum.
 

ÖmerBey

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2012
Mesajlar
4,324
Excel Vers. ve Dili
2007 Türkçe
Aynı işlemi ThisWorkbook yerine ActiveWorkbook yazarak deneyiniz. Yine olmazsa ben sorununuzu yanlış anladım demektir.
 

ÖmerBey

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2012
Mesajlar
4,324
Excel Vers. ve Dili
2007 Türkçe
Hayırlı geceler,
İyi çalışmalar...
 
Katılım
29 Aralık 2008
Mesajlar
21
Excel Vers. ve Dili
2007
Hayırlı geceler,
İyi çalışmalar...
Ömer Bey Merhaba;

full test şablonunun konumunu değiştirdik. Makro çalışmamaktadır.

\\ablkfs\BLK_ORTAK\KALITE_KONTROL\MELAMİN_PRESLER_TEST_SONUCLARI\YONGA LEVHA LABORATUVAR\MACRO FULL TEST İŞLEME\LAK KOLAY İŞLEME

Ekteki konumdaki şablon excell i makro ile açıp, a2:f7 aralığını kopyalayıp active work book a yapıştırmak istiyorum. sonra da şablon excell ini kapatmak istiyorum.

hangi kodları kullanmam gerekmektedir?

teşekkür ederim.

iyi çalışmalar.
saygılarımla.
 
Üst